The history of the Urdu community in Burma (now Myanmar) is marked by periods of conflicts and challenges, shaping the community's identity and experiences in the region. The Urdu community in Burma has a rich history, with roots tracing back to the British colonial period when significant numbers of Urdu-speaking people migrated to Burma for various reasons, including trade and employment opportunities.

One of the major conflicts faced by the Urdu community in Burma occurred during World War II when the country was under Japanese occupation. The Japanese forces viewed the Urdu-speaking population, along with other South Asian communities, with suspicion and subjected them to discrimination and violence. Many Urdu-speaking people were forced to flee their homes and seek refuge in other parts of Burma or across the border in neighboring countries. Following Burma's independence in 1948, the Urdu community faced further challenges as the newly formed government implemented policies that marginalized minority groups, including Urdu speakers. The government's emphasis on promoting Burmese language and culture led to the marginalization of non-Burmese communities, including the Urdu-speaking population. In more recent years, the Rohingya crisis has brought renewed attention to the plight of minority communities in Burma, including the Urdu-speaking community. The Rohingya, who are predominantly Muslims and speak a dialect of Urdu, have been subjected to persecution and violence by the Burmese military, leading to a mass exodus of Rohingya refugees to neighboring countries. Despite these challenges and conflicts, the Urdu community in Burma has shown resilience and strength in preserving its cultural identity and heritage. Community organizations and activists continue to advocate for the rights and recognition of the Urdu-speaking population in Burma, pushing for greater inclusion and representation in the country's multicultural society.
